Iowa Connect Internet Plans & Pricing

PlanMonthly PriceTypical Download SpeedTypical Upload SpeedConnection Type
RCSI Wireless Internet - 6MB$44.956 Mbps6 MbpsFixed Wireless
RCSI Wireless Internet - 8MB$54.958 Mbps8 MbpsFixed Wireless
RCSI Wireless Internet - 15MB$59.9515 Mbps15 MbpsFixed Wireless
RCSI Wireless Internet - 25MB$69.9525 Mbps25 MbpsFixed Wireless

Sourced from pricing published on Iowa Connect's official website. These provider-reported typical speeds reflect plan-specific expectations, while speed metrics elsewhere on our site measure maximum available performance across areas. Pricing is subject to change and may not be available in all areas.

Rockwell Internet Plans & Pricing

PlanMonthly PriceTypical Download SpeedTypical Upload SpeedConnection Type
25/25 MG$44.9525 Mbps25 MbpsFiber
100/100 MG$69.95100 Mbps100 MbpsFiber
250/250 MG$99.95250 Mbps250 MbpsFiber
500/500 MG$134.95500 Mbps500 MbpsFiber
1 GB/ 1 GB$199.951000 Mbps1000 MbpsFiber

Sourced from pricing published on Rockwell's official website. These provider-reported typical speeds reflect plan-specific expectations, while speed metrics elsewhere on our site measure maximum available performance across areas. Pricing is subject to change and may not be available in all areas.

Most households with 3-5 users need download speeds of at least 100 Mbps for smooth streaming, video conferencing, and everyday internet usage. Larger households or those with heavy users (gamers, 4K streamers, or remote workers) should consider plans with speeds of 300 Mbps or more for optimal performance.

When comparing internet providers, remember that advertised prices rarely tell the complete story. Equipment fees alone can add $10-15 per month to your bill, while installation charges, early termination fees, and data overage penalties can significantly increase your total cost of service. Consider these additional costs alongside monthly rates when determining which provider offers the better value for your specific needs.
